The single CXAO42154A and dual CXAO42154B CMOS operational amplifiers provide very low offset voltage and zero-drift over time and temperature

The single CXAO42154A and dual CXAO42154B CMOS operational amplifiers provide very low offset voltage and zero-drift over time and temperature.
The miniature, high-precision, low quiescent current amplifiers offer high-impedance inputs that have a wide input common mode range 100mV beyond the rails and rail-to-rail output that swings within 14mV of the rails. Single or dual supplies as low as +1.8V (±0.9V) and up to +5.5V (±2.75V) may be used.They are optimized for low voltage, single supply operation.
The CXAO42154A/B offer excellent CMRR without the crossover associated with traditional complementary input stages. This design results in superior performance for driving analog-to-digital converters (ADCs) without degradation of differential linearity.
The single CXAO42154A is available in Green SOT-23-5, SC70-5 and SOIC-8 packages. The dual CXAO42154B is available in GreenSOIC-8, MSOP-8 and TDFN-3×3-8L packages. They are specified over -40℃ to +125℃ temperature range.
